Solving word problems in mathematics can be challenging, but by following a step-by-step approach, you can simplify the process and increase your chances of finding the correct solution. The first step is to read the problem thoroughly, identifying all relevant information and understanding what is being asked. Next, plan your approach by deciding on a strategy, breaking down the problem into smaller parts if possible, and drawing a diagram to visualize the problem. After that, solve the problem by writing down the equations or expressions you will use, solving them step by step, and checking your work to make sure your answer makes sense and satisfies the original conditions of the problem. Finally, write your answer in a clear and concise manner, explain how you arrived at it if necessary, and check your work again to make sure you didn't make any careless mistakes. By practicing these steps, you should be able to solve most word problems in mathematics.

Number sense is a crucial skill for effective problem-solving, involving an intuitive understanding of numbers and their relationships. It's important for efficiency, flexibility, and confidence in handling numerical tasks. To improve your number sense and estimation skills, practice rounding and estimating, use benchmark numbers, work with different representations, engage in mental math exercises, analyze mistakes, and seek out challenging problems. Consistent practice and real-world applications are key to developing a more intuitive understanding of numbers and enhancing problem-solving abilities.

Managing time effectively during exams is crucial for success. Here are strategies to help you prepare, allocate time wisely, prioritize questions, maintain a steady pace, review your work, manage stress, and stay healthy: 1. **Preparation**: Understand the exam format, practice with past papers, and study in advance to reduce last-minute stress. 2. **Time Allocation**: Allocate time according to the marks of each question, read instructions carefully, and be realistic about the time spent on each question. 3. **Prioritization**: Answer easy questions first to build confidence and mark difficult ones for review later. 4. **Pacing**: Keep an eye on the clock and maintain a comfortable pace to ensure all questions are answered thoroughly. 5. **Review and Adjustment**: Leave time at the end to review answers and check for errors. 6. **Stress Management**: Stay calm using deep breaths and relaxation techniques to manage stress during the exam. 7. **Health and Hydration**: Stay hydrated and eat lightly to maintain energy levels. By following these strategies, you can maximize your efficiency and performance during exams.

Troubleshooting common issues with AC stepping motors involves addressing problems such as missing steps or low torque. This is done by checking the power supply, examining the drive system, analyzing mechanical components, evaluating control signals, and considering environmental factors. It is important to approach the problem methodically, starting with basic checks before moving on to more complex diagnostics.
